A new trailer for Halo: Campaign Evolved was shown at the "XBOX Games Showcase 2026" presentation. The remake of the shooter is being developed by the Halo Studios team.
The project's creators revealed that the Halo: CE remake will feature a story arc called Operation: Meteorite, which is a prequel chronologically. The developers will introduce three new missions: the story will center on Master Chief and Sergeant Johnson, who infiltrate a mysterious Covenant ship on a secret mission.
Halo: Campaign Evolved is positioned as a modernized remake of the Halo: Combat Evolved campaign:
Discover the original story, recreated with high-definition visuals, updated cinematics, and improved controls, plus an all-new three-mission adventure featuring Master Chief and Sergeant Johnson. An expanded arsenal of weapons, vehicles, and enemies, as well as "Skulls" (additional modifiers that change gameplay) add new tactics and endless replayability.
Halo: Campaign Evolved can be added to your Steam wishlist via this link. The release is scheduled for July 28, 2026, on PC, Xbox Series X|S consoles, and PlayStation 5. Owners of the Premium Edition will have the opportunity to start playing five days earlier.
